Agent Sasco Diss Kartel with Dem Bad in A Gang

August 12th, 2011 | By

Boardhouse recording artist Assassin recently released Dem Bad Inna Gang which appears to address rumors of the infamous face with Kartel at the Shocking Vibes studio about two months ago.

In the song Assassin makes reference to phone calls Kartel made at the time as well as other stinging remarks aimed at the self proclaimed Dancehall Hero.

The song appears on the Boardhouse Records Big Dog Riddim which also features Lady Ali, Ricky Frass, Twins of Twins among others.

Tajji former Octane songwriter delivers with That Dem a Say

August 12th, 2011 | By

26 year old songwriter Tajji is not a regular deejay with simple rhymes and a inflated ego due to the incredible success of the tunes he has written.

Tajji is credited with writing several songs for I Octane including his most iconic hits Lose a Friend, My Life, Think a Little Time, Mama You Alone and Puff It.

Tajji says that the two met in the studio while he was voicing a track several years ago.  Octane noticed Tajji’s talent and the two immediately became close friends.

Since parting ways with Octane about three months ago Tajji has been hard at work in the studio.

He says it wasn’t a grudgeful business parting and he does not regret the years he spent helping him build his career.

That Dem A Say one of Tajji’s latest releases is already getting positive response from the underground circuit.

Psalms 119-The longest Psalm-113 thru 144

August 12th, 2011 | By

113 SAMECH. I hate [vain] thoughts: but thy law do I love.

114 Thou [art] my hiding place and my shield: I hope in thy word.

115 Depart from me, ye evildoers: for I will keep the commandments of my God.

116 Uphold me according unto thy word, that I may live: and let me not be ashamed of my hope.

117 Hold thou me up, and I shall be safe: and I will have respect unto thy statutes continually.

118 Thou hast trodden down all them that err from thy statutes: for their deceit [is] falsehood.

119 Thou puttest away all the wicked of the earth [like] dross: therefore I love thy testimonies.

120 My flesh trembleth for fear of thee; and I am afraid of thy judgments.

121 AIN. I have done judgment and justice: leave me not to mine oppressors.

122 Be surety for thy servant for good: let not the proud oppress me.

123 Mine eyes fail for thy salvation, and for the word of thy righteousness.

124 Deal with thy servant according unto thy mercy, and teach me thy statutes.

125 I [am] thy servant; give me understanding, that I may know thy testimonies.

126 [It is] time for [thee], LORD, to work: [for] they have made void thy law.

127 Therefore I love thy commandments above gold; yea, above fine gold.

128 Therefore I esteem all [thy] precepts [concerning] all [things to be] right; [and] I hate every false way.

129 PE. Thy testimonies [are] wonderful: therefore doth my soul keep them.

130 The entrance of thy words giveth light; it giveth understanding unto the simple.

131 I opened my mouth, and panted: for I longed for thy commandments.

132 Look thou upon me, and be merciful unto me, as thou usest to do unto those that love thy name.

133 Order my steps in thy word: and let not any iniquity have dominion over me.

134 Deliver me from the oppression of man: so will I keep thy precepts.

135 Make thy face to shine upon thy servant; and teach me thy statutes.

136 Rivers of waters run down mine eyes, because they keep not thy law.

137 TZADDI. Righteous [art] thou, O LORD, and upright [are] thy judgments.

138 Thy testimonies [that] thou hast commanded [are] righteous and very faithful.

139 My zeal hath consumed me, because mine enemies have forgotten thy words.

140 Thy word [is] very pure: therefore thy servant loveth it.

141 I [am] small and despised: [yet] do not I forget thy precepts.

142 Thy righteousness [is] an everlasting righteousness, and thy law [is] the truth.

143 Trouble and anguish have taken hold on me: [yet] thy commandments [are] my delights.

144 The righteousness of thy testimonies [is] everlasting: give me understanding, and I shall live.
